Due to the high number of wrongful convictions occurring in the US, the FSC Chapter of the Deskovic Foundation is a non-profit organization dedicated to helping exonerate the wrongfully convicted & reform the criminal justice system.

Come join us for a movie night! 🍿⭐️

Bring your friends and watch Frontline: The Confessions starting at 4pm on November 5th in B202!

🎬 synopsis: Why would four innocent men confess to a brutal crime they didn’t commit? FRONTLINE goes inside the saga of the Norfolk Four.
